Accident Beechcraft C-45F Expeditor 44-87112, Saturday 4 March 1950

Date:Saturday 4 March 1950
Time:18:40
Type:Silhouette image of generic BE18 model; specific model in this crash may look slightly different    
Beechcraft C-45F Expeditor
Owner/operator:United States Air Force - USAF
Registration: 44-87112
MSN: 8371
Fatalities:Fatalities: 6 / Occupants: 6
Other fatalities:0
Aircraft damage: Destroyed
Location:Lake Michigan 4 to 6 Mi E Milwaukee, WI -   United States of America
Phase: Approach
Nature:Military
Departure airport:Bolling AFB, Washington DC
Destination airport:Mitchell Field, Milwaukee, WI
Narrative:
Crashed into Lake Michigan after running out of fuel.
